CST 眼圖仿真實例(上)- 生成眼圖的兩種方法
本期介紹如何在CST中的進行眼圖仿真。考慮到眼圖是一個很大的話題為防止太監了,所以嘗試分成幾個部分來講,可能是上中下三集。
為了達到能快速演示功能的目的,第一集我們用一個簡單的微帶線走線作為通道仿真的模型。這個模型我們在之前的TDR中有介紹過建模的過程“CST TDR時域仿真實例”。在對模型另一端的器件也改成端口后,我們得到如下的通道模型(單端走線)如下圖所示:
下面我們用幾個步驟歸納一下這種通道的眼圖仿真的步驟:
Step1: 仿真S參數得到頻率響應
在本例中只要開始仿真即可得到3D下的S參數結果如下圖位置所示:
Step2: 切換到原理圖Schematic頁面
我們添加兩個端口如下圖所示:當然如果加以變化也一樣適用其他的傳輸通道類型,見FAQ 007:如何將單端轉換為差模共模。
這時候我們可以創建一個S-parameter的任務如下圖所示:
點擊創建的S-para1圖標如下圖所示:
然后在左下角的Task Parameter List(Spara1)表格里選擇,Termination,可以改動端口阻抗(Renormalize),例如把兩個端口都改成100歐姆,如下圖所示。
這時候是屬于基于場仿真的結果進行的路仿真,通常幾秒鐘就可以完成,對于這個微帶線的S參數如下圖所示:
Step3: 眼圖工具
如果用S參數生成眼圖只要選擇相應的通道,并且知道上下延的時間即可,如下圖所示:
假設我們仿真的信號位寬Bit Length: 1ns(1/1GBps 比特率),如果已知上下升延0.1ns,選擇Calc.Resp.from S-parameter,并且選擇S2,1這個通道,如下圖所示:
點擊OK后,會生成一個類似后處理的模板(Post-processing),Update那個PP1的模塊,就可以得到眼圖的結果如下所示:
重點推薦方法2——通過信號響應生成
如果用階躍信號生成眼圖,需要創建一個瞬態任務Trasient task,如下圖所示:
設置仿真總時長200ns,如下圖所示:
設置生成激勵源的階躍信號如下圖所示:
上圖位置也能修改負載阻抗。
結果如下圖所示:
注:這邊存在一個頻域結果Vector fitting的過程,如果宏模型生成不佳的情況下就需要IDEM工具出場了,仿真實例006:用IDEMWORK提取寬帶宏模型(上)仿真實例007:用IDEMWORK提取寬帶宏模型(下)。
得到瞬態相應后,再次打開眼圖工具,進行如下設置,這次選擇瞬態的階躍信號相應:
Update生成的第二個后處理眼圖工具PP2,如下圖所示:
當然還可以用宏加上眼圖mask,Marcos\Result\Eye diagram, TDR \Draw Eye diagram Mask,位置如下圖所示:
點擊Staristical Eye PDF可以看到彩色的眼圖如下圖位置:
因為本例的反射大,損耗很小,顯示不是特別清晰,我另外找了一張作為示意:
除了以上幾種圖以外在Eye-properties可以找到各種相關的信息。
本次介紹了利用眼圖工具Eye diagram tools生成眼圖的兩種方法,下期再介紹更多眼圖設置內容。